How It Stitches: Clarity, Flow, and Fabric Respect

In real embroidery use, Womens Plant Mommy Svg, Plants Svg, Mom holds up well across common apparel and home goods. On medium-weight cotton (think t-shirts, tote bags, pillow covers), the design translates cleanly — especially the leaf outlines and letterforms. The wildflower stems are thin enough to avoid dense fill-stitch buildup, and the cactus shape has clean, open contours that let satin stitch wrap smoothly without puckering. I tested it on a relaxed-fit crewneck sweatshirt: with tear-away stabilizer and 40-weight rayon thread, the result felt handmade but polished — not stiff, not pixelated, not lost in the fabric texture.

Where it shines most is in personalized gifts and small shop merchandise. A customer ordering a “Plant Mommy” embroidered kitchen towel? This design delivers warmth and specificity without needing custom lettering. An Etsy seller bundling it with succulent-themed patches or printable nursery art? Its visual tone aligns seamlessly. It reads clearly at 3.5–4 inches wide — ideal for left-chest placement on tees or centered on the back of a child’s denim jacket.

Use With Care: Where Detail Meets Reality

This isn’t a one-size-fits-all embroidery file. On stretchy fabrics like jersey knits or lightweight ribbed cotton, the lettering and finer wildflower lines need extra stabilization — a light cutaway plus topping works best. On dark fabric, avoid light-colored thread for the smallest stems; they’ll disappear unless you add a subtle underlay or switch to a slightly bolder stitch path. And while the design looks lovely on paper mockups, don’t assume it’ll read well on curved surfaces like baseball caps — the bottom curve of “Mommy” can distort unless digitized with cap-specific adjustments (which this SVG/DXF doesn’t include).

Also worth noting: the wildflower details are charming but delicate. On textured fabrics (burlap, heavy canvas, looped terry), those tiny petals may get lost or snag during stitching. For baby embroidery or items meant for frequent washing, simplify by removing the smallest flower elements before digitizing — it preserves the spirit without risking thread breaks or fuzzy edges over time.
